CBS keeps studio crew home, invites pestering

sryan_sm.jpgSmithtown's own Sam Ryan was on the scene in San Antonio for Monday night's NCAA title tilt, but where were her friends Greg, Clark and Seth?

Yeah, I know it's Thursday already and it's baseball/golf/hockey season. But since I got several questions about CBS's decision not to send its studio team to the Final Four and since I bothered CBS's p.r. people with e-mails on that subject before and during the big game, I figured I might as well share the explanation:

Short version: There is no reason to do so for the Saturday afternoon Final Four pregame show, as it mostly would occur with an empty arena as a backdrop. And there wasn't a good enough reason to go through the time, hassle (and, presumably, money) involved in schlepping to Texas Monday for the sake of 10 minutes before throwing the action to Jim Nantz and Billy Packer.

After watching Fox's NFL studio crew nearly turn into ice sculptures in Green Bay in January, I've decided on-site pregames are overrated and perhaps life-threatening.

As CBS's spokeswoman correctly noted as I pestered her Monday night, "Honestly, no one has asked and no one but a TV writer would care."
